The Siberian Husky's very thick coat makes it very resistant to extreme temperatures. And for good reason, the breed originates from the Kamchatka Peninsula, in Eastern Siberia. It is the Chukchi people who bred the Husky to its present form. By eliminating the aggressive elements of the litters, the people made them a perfect breed for work, and pet for children.

The Siberian Husky is indeed a breed with gentle and rather sociable behaviour. It is generally the perfect pet for children but you shouldn't make a watchdog of your Husky because they are not particularly suspicious about strangers or even other dogs. Huskies can have a tendency to run off because they love the great outdoors. Huskies are still frequently used to pull dog sleds in the Arctic regions of the globe.
